Fontenelle Forest is working to reopen trails safely after unprecedented wind storm

July 13, 2021 8:56 am Published by Comments Off on Fontenelle Forest is working to reopen trails safely after unprecedented wind storm

The wind storm that swept through Omaha on Friday, July 9, was one of the worst in recent history. With over 2,100 acres and 24 miles of trails, it will take some time for Fontenelle Forest to ensure all the trails are safe to reopen for public use. Forest staff...

The wetlands at Fontenelle Forest – a favorite area for hikers and birders – is now open!

May 17, 2021 6:00 am Published by Comments Off on The wetlands at Fontenelle Forest – a favorite area for hikers and birders – is now open!

We are very excited to announce that after more than two years of flood recovery work, access to the south wetlands is OPEN! Why was it closed? In the fall of 2018, Hidden Lake Trail froze with several inches to one foot of water on it. Due to this our...
